- Upload Audio — Drag and drop an audio file onto the drop zone, or click to browse. Supports MP3, WAV, OGG, FLAC, M4A, and AAC formats. The audio is decoded entirely in your browser.
- Choose Style — Select from 3 visualization styles: Bars (vertical columns), Mirror (symmetric top/bottom), or Line (filled waveform shape). Toggle Rounded corners for smooth bar tops. Enable Gradient for a multi-color hue-shifted effect.
- Customize Colors — Pick a wave color and background color using the color pickers. Enable 'Transparent BG' for PNG images with no background (perfect for overlays).
- Adjust Dimensions — Set canvas Width (400–2400px) and Height (100–800px). Control Bar Width (1–12px) and Bar Gap (0–6px) for density and spacing.
- Export — Click 'Export PNG' to download the waveform as a high-resolution PNG image. The file is generated directly from the canvas.
Audio Waveform Generator — Create Beautiful Waveform Images from Audio
The Audio Waveform Generator creates stunning visual representations of audio files. Upload any audio file (MP3, WAV, OGG, FLAC, M4A, AAC), customize the appearance with 3 styles, colors, and dimensions, and export as a high-resolution PNG — all processed in your browser.
Waveform images are essential for podcasts, music production, social media content, and video editing. This tool makes creating them effortless without installing any software.
Key Features
- Multi-Format Support — Accepts MP3, WAV, OGG, FLAC, M4A, AAC, and any format supported by your browser's Web Audio API. Files are decoded instantly.
- 3 Visualization Styles — Bars (classic vertical columns centered), Mirror (symmetric above and below center line), and Line (filled waveform shape with smooth curves).
- Rounded Corners — Toggle between rounded (smooth) and sharp (angular) bar tops for different aesthetics.
- Gradient Mode — Apply a multi-color gradient across the waveform by automatically shifting the base color's hue. Creates vibrant, rainbow-like effects.
- Custom Colors — Full color picker for both wave color and background color. Match your brand, album art, or social media aesthetic.
- Transparent Background — Export with a transparent background for easy overlay on videos, websites, and images.
- Custom Dimensions — Width from 400 to 2400px and height from 100 to 800px. Perfect for social media banners (1200×300), video thumbnails, or website headers.
- Bar Width & Gap — Control the thickness (1–12px) and spacing (0–6px) of waveform bars for dense or sparse visualizations.
- Audio Info — Displays file name, duration, sample rate, and number of channels after loading.
- PNG Export — Download the waveform as a high-quality PNG image directly from the HTML5 canvas.
Use Cases
- Podcasts — Create audio waveform images for podcast episode posts on social media, blogs, and websites.
- Music Production — Generate visual representations of tracks for SoundCloud, Bandcamp, or album artwork.
- Social Media — Create eye-catching audio visualization posts for Instagram, Twitter, YouTube thumbnails, and TikTok.
- Video Editing — Use transparent waveform images as overlays in video projects (Premiere Pro, DaVinci Resolve, Final Cut).
- Web Design — Add waveform graphics to music-related websites, streaming platforms, and audio player interfaces.
- Presentations — Include waveform visuals in slides about audio, music, or sound design topics.
Privacy & Security
The Audio Waveform Generator uses the Web Audio API entirely in your browser. Audio files are decoded locally as ArrayBuffers — they are never uploaded to any server. The PNG export is generated from the HTML5 canvas. The tool works completely offline once loaded.